Proventeq, a Microsoft Solutions for Modern Work provider, is seeking a Technical Team Lead in Reading to drive software design and delivery using C#/.
Net, React, Azure APIs and SQL Server.
You will mentor junior developers, perform code reviews, and engage with customers for project execution.
Ideal candidates have 7+ years in software development, proven leadership in Agile environments, and strong communication skills to interact with clients and stakeholders.

✨Prepare for Behavioural Questions
While technical skills are key, full-time positions also require cultural fit. Be ready to discuss our previous experiences and how we handle teamwork, conflict, and deadlines. Brush up on the STAR method—Situation, Task, Action, Result—to clearly articulate our past experiences when discussing how we've contributed to a team.
